Birth Flower

Did you know that every month of the year has a flower associated with it? This flower is supposed to represent the qualities people who are born in that particular month poses.  Here’s what each of them are supposed to be:

January – Carnation – Represents fascination and imagination
February – Violet – Represents modesty and simplicity
March – Phlox – Represents sweet dreams and soul
April – Daisy – Represents innocence and gentleness
May – Cosmos – Represents intellect and confidence
June – Rose – Represents love and appreciation
July – Larkspur – Represents lightness and levity
August – Poppy – Represents dreaminess and imagination
September – Aster – Represents modesty and patience
October – Marigold – Represents passion and creativity
November – Chrysanthemum – Represents truth and friendship
December – Cornflower – Represents vitality and prosperity
